Chris and Veronica’s wedding day was a perfect reflection of this unique couple: stylish, individual, quirky, fun, Jaguar-obsessed and covered in penguins. Seriously, I have never seen so many penguins gathered in one place before!

So much time and effort had gone into the styling of this amazing wedding: from the vintage afternoon tea crockery, to the couple’s own crest (featuring penguins – naturally) adorning everything from massive banners to tiny lapel pins, to teh oversized balloons, it was like walking into another world of pink and blue vintage lovliness. This wonderful bride and groom were lucky enough to have their wedding ceremony outdoors, in the stunning grounds of Woodhall Spa Manor. Look at how gorgeous it was!

VinTEAge supplied a beautiful afternoon tea (and ladbies, you looked as good as the tea itself!) and the evening food was the amazing pizza from The Rustic Crust (and I mean AMAZING pizza!). A big shout out too to the team at Mambo Bars – the cocktails seemed to be going down very well as did the barmen and their antics!

There was lots going on in the evening, as well as amazing food and drink, there were casino tables and dancing to a live band.
